AMD Athlon 64 X2 3800+ testing with a ASUS M2N-SLI DELUXE and eVGA NVIDIA GeForce GT 630 2048MB on Arch rolling via the Phoronix Test Suite.
AMD Athlon 64 X2 3800
Processor: AMD Athlon 64 X2 3800+ @ 2.00GHz (2 Cores), Motherboard: ASUS M2N-SLI DELUXE, Chipset: NVIDIA MCP55, Memory: 4096MB, Disk: 80GB Western Digital WD800BB-22JH + 250GB Western Digital WD2500KS-00M, Graphics: eVGA NVIDIA GeForce GT 630 2048MB (810/697MHz), Audio: Analog Devices AD1988B
OS: Arch rolling, Kernel: 3.14.43-2-lts (x86_64), Desktop: KDE Frameworks 5, Display Driver: NVIDIA 352.09, Compiler: GCC 5.1.0 + CUDA 7.0, File-System: ext4, Screen Resolution: 2304x1024
Processor Notes: Scaling Governor: powernow-k8 ondemand
CacheBench
This is a performance test of CacheBench, which is part of LLCbench. CacheBench is designed to test the memory and cache bandwidth performance Learn more via the OpenBenchmarking.org test page.
